Retail gold prices (gold rates) in India remained unchanged on Sunday, May 17, stabilising after experiencing sharp consecutive drops later in the week. According to the tracking platform GoodReturns, the national average for 24-karat gold holds at INR 15,693 per gram, while 22-karat gold is priced at INR 14,385 per gram. The pause in price movement reflects a standard weekend freeze in the physical bullion markets, allowing buyers and investors to evaluate the recent volatility driven by shifting global cues and domestic pressures.

Regional Variances in Key Metro Markets

Despite a uniform national trend over the last 24 hours, local price structures continue to display marginal variations due to localised transportation costs, regional octroi, and varying state-level taxation policies. In Mumbai, Kolkata, Bangalore, and Hyderabad, 24-karat retail rates are aligned precisely with the national average at INR 15,693 per gram. Delhi displays a slight premium, with pure gold trading at INR 15,708 per gram. Chennai continues to report the highest baseline among the major metros, where a single gram of 24-karat gold is priced at INR 16,091, and 22-karat gold rests at INR 14,750 per gram.

Market Context and Underlying Drivers

The weekend plateau follows a highly turbulent week for the precious metal, which hit monthly highs on May 14 before retreating significantly. Bullion analysts point out that hotter-than-expected inflation metrics from the United States and a subsequently firmer US Dollar index have temporarily dented the non-yielding asset's upward trajectory. Dubai Gold Rate Today: 18K, 22K, 24K Gold Prices for May 16, 2026.

As the broader market absorbs these global macro factors alongside localised demand cycles, retail consumer traffic at major jewellery hubs is expected to remain steady but highly price-conscious ahead of the upcoming wedding season.
